Certified Nurse Assistant (CNA) - Weekend coverage only

Overview Part of CentraState Healthcare System - The Manor Health & Rehabilitation Center is a 123 bed sub-acute and long-term care skilled nursing facility. The Manor offers comprehensive short-term rehabilitation and long-term skilled nursing services for adults ages 18 and older. In addition to providing award-winning care, we are committed to helping patients and residents achieve their maximum potential for independence, comfort, and quality of life. The Manor has been named one of the Best Nursing Homes by U.S. News & World Report , a nationally recognized magazine that routinely evaluates and rates health care providers across the country. The Manor has also received the highest overall quality rating – five stars – from the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services (CMS) Five-Star Quality Rating System. The Certified Nurse Assistant provides daily assistance of ADLs for residents and supportive nursing assistance to licensed professionals by performing assigned duties and services required to deliver quality patient care. Follows established standards, NJ Department of Health and Senior Services laws, JCAHO, and CentraState Medical Center policy and procedures. WEEKEND coverage only. Can be every weekend or every other: day shift 7a-3p Responsibilities Provides considerate respectful care focused upon the Residents' individual needs. Affirms the Resident's right to make decisions regarding his/her medical care, including the decision to discontinue treatment, to the extent permitted by law. Demonstrates the ability to obtain information and interpret information in terms of the needs of the age of the Residents cared for. Demonstrates an understanding of the range of care needed based on the age of the Residents cared for. Demonstrates knowledge of growth, development and/or adult health throughout the life span as appropriate to the job performed. Successfully completes life-span education as appropriate. Accurately reports concerns or a change in Resident status to the RN/LPN. Provides partial and complete personal care to the residents. Assists in performing tasks to maintain resident mobility. Assists with Resident meal services and participates in the maintenance of the nutritional and hydration needs of the Resident. Verbalizes understanding that pain management is a priority to Resident and nurse. Notifies nurse immediately of Residents having pain/discomfort. Collects resident data utilizing learned technical skills. Assures Resident is safe prior to leaving them:- Has all items within reach- Call bell within reach- Alarms attached and working Restraints are applied according to care plan- Bed/ Chair proper level and location- Foot rests attached to wheelchair- Assures residents room is tidy prior to leaving. Informs resident and escorts to activity as necessary. Assists residents with toileting and has proper incontinent product as per care plan. Attends IDCP meetings regarding your resident (depending on shift). Assures C.N.A care plan is accurate and updates when indicated. Communicates ideas and observations. Promotes a positive attitude with residents and families. Continually improves quality of services provided. Qualifications High school graduate or equivalency preferred. Related experience preferred. Active NJ CNA (Certified Nurses Assistant) required. Strong professional, organizational, and interpersonal skills to effectively relate with all members of the healthcare team. Dialysis Hospital Services Nurse Coordinator (Acute RN)

Overview Dialysis Clinic, Inc. is recruiting top talent interested in supporting our nonprofit mission to prioritize individualized care for hospitalized patients facing acute kidney injury and chronic kidney disease. Our mission states “the care of the patient is our reason for existence,” and our dedicated team embodies our sole purpose during every patient interaction. We seek motivated, compassionate individuals to provide top-notch patient care and offer paid training, competitive pay, outstanding benefits and a positive, mission-driven culture. Join DCI today to build relationships and gain fulfillment caring for dialysis patients in an acute care environment. The Dialysis Hospital Services Nurse Coordinator (Acute RN) provides specialized dialysis, renal nursing care, and if contractually required, plasmapheresis treatments in our Centrastate acute hemodialysis unit. The Acute RN collaborates with hospital and outpatient care team members to ensure patients receive the safest care with the highest-quality outcomes. Schedule: Full-time, five 8-hour shifts starting at 8:30am. Some positions are on call 24/7, and rotating call may be required at some locations. Compensation: Pay range from $87,000-$125,000 annually depending on nursing and dialysis experience; experience preferred Benefits: Up to 12 weeks paid training with preceptor Comprehensive medical, dental and vision benefits Life and long-term disability insurance provided at no additional expense to employee Paid time off (PTO) including holidays Extended Sick Bank (ESB) in addition to PTO – paid time for doctor appointments, sickness or medical leave Retirement plans with $.50 of each contributed dollar matched for eligible employees, up to 8 percent Education reimbursement Employee assistance program Wellness program Among others Responsibilities What You Can Expect: Prepare and monitor equipment used for intermittent or continuous dialysis and water treatment in the acute setting, including quality control checks Perform and document pre-, intra- and post-dialysis assessments Initiate, monitor and terminate dialysis treatments per established policies and procedures Dispense medication as ordered and document per policy and procedure in hospital medical record Administer blood and blood products per hospital policy and procedure Accurately receive, transcribe and implement written and verbal orders from physicians Access lab reports, interpret and report necessary information to nephrologist Provide renal education to patients and family members and document appropriately Serve as primary dialysis contact for nephrologists and hospital staff and liaison to outpatient dialysis center Adhere to DCI and hospital policies and procedures including proper completion of occurrence reports as necessary Additional tasks as necessary Qualifications Successful Candidates Bring: Excellent communication skills Demonstrated clinical proficiency Desire to collaborate with care teams Ability to problem solve Customer service mindset in communicating with patients, team members and partner hospital Education/Training: Current NJ RN license required Six months’ dialysis and/or critical care nursing experience preferred, job shadow opportunities available Current CPR and BLS certifications DCI’s Differentiator: Since opening the first clinic 50 years ago in Nashville, Tenn., our Dialysis Clinic, Inc. family has grown to be the nation’s largest nonprofit dialysis provider with more than 270 locations in 30 states, serving nearly 14,000 patients each day.
